The Energy Conservation Act, 2001, and the Establishment of BEE
The Energy Conservation Act, 2001, was enacted to address India’s growing energy demands and reduce the energy intensity of its economy. This legislation mandated the creation of the Bureau of Energy Efficiency (BEE) as a statutory body on March 1, 2002. BEE was tasked with implementing the Act’s provisions, focusing on promoting energy efficiency and conservation across various sectors. The Act provided the legal framework for BEE to develop policies, standards, and programs to achieve these goals. Key initiatives under the Act include establishing energy efficiency standards, promoting the use of renewable energy, and implementing market-based mechanisms to encourage sustainable practices. The establishment of BEE marked a significant step in India’s commitment to achieving energy security and environmental sustainability.

Standards and Labelling Program for Energy-Efficient Appliances
The Standards and Labelling Program, launched by BEE, aims to promote energy-efficient appliances by assigning star ratings based on energy performance. This initiative helps consumers identify and choose energy-efficient products, reducing overall energy consumption. The program covers a wide range of appliances, including air conditioners, refrigerators, and lighting systems. By setting minimum energy performance standards and providing clear labels, BEE encourages manufacturers to adopt energy-efficient technologies. This program has significantly contributed to energy savings and emission reduction in India, aligning with global climate goals and fostering sustainable development.
Perform Achieve and Trade (PAT) Scheme for Industries
The Perform Achieve and Trade (PAT) Scheme is a market-based initiative by BEE to enhance energy efficiency in energy-intensive industries. It sets specific energy consumption targets for industries, requiring them to meet these benchmarks. If industries exceed their targets, they earn energy savings certificates, which can be traded. This mechanism incentivizes industries to adopt energy-efficient technologies and practices. The scheme covers sectors like cement, steel, and power, contributing significantly to India’s energy savings and emission reduction goals. By fostering competition and innovation, PAT has become a cornerstone of India’s climate action, aligning industrial growth with sustainable development.
Energy Efficiency in Buildings: ECBC and ENS Codes
The Energy Conservation Building Code (ECBC) and Energy Norms and Standards (ENS) are key initiatives by BEE to promote energy efficiency in the building sector. ECBC, launched in 2007, is a mandatory code for commercial buildings, providing guidelines for energy-efficient design, construction, and operation. It covers aspects like building envelope, lighting, HVAC systems, and renewable energy integration. ENS, introduced in 2023, extends these principles to residential buildings, setting minimum energy performance standards. These codes aim to reduce energy consumption, lower carbon emissions, and promote sustainable urban development. By adopting ECBC and ENS, India is fostering a culture of energy efficiency, encouraging the use of advanced technologies, and aligning with global sustainability goals. These codes are critical for achieving long-term energy security and environmental benefits.

State Energy Efficiency Index (SEEI) and Its Significance
The State Energy Efficiency Index (SEEI) is a joint initiative by the Bureau of Energy Efficiency (BEE) and the Alliance for an Energy-Efficient Economy (AEEE) to evaluate the progress of energy efficiency measures across Indian states. First launched in 2018, the index assesses states based on their performance in key sectors such as buildings, industries, transport, agriculture, and DISCOMs. SEEI serves as a benchmarking tool, fostering competition among states to improve energy efficiency. It provides detailed analysis, highlighting achievements and identifying gaps, while offering actionable recommendations. This index plays a critical role in aligning state-level initiatives with national energy goals, ensuring a coordinated approach to reducing energy consumption and promoting sustainable development across India.

Energy Efficiency in the Railway and Agricultural Sectors
The Bureau of Energy Efficiency (BEE) has initiated targeted programs to enhance energy efficiency in the railway and agricultural sectors. In the railway sector, BEE promotes the adoption of energy-efficient technologies such as electric traction and regenerative braking systems. Additionally, the use of renewable energy sources, like solar power for lighting and station operations, has been encouraged to reduce dependency on conventional energy. In the agricultural sector, BEE focuses on optimizing energy use in irrigation systems and promoting energy-efficient pumps under the AgDSM (Agricultural Demand-Side Management) program. These initiatives aim to reduce energy consumption, lower operational costs, and contribute to India’s climate goals by minimizing greenhouse gas emissions. BEE’s efforts in these sectors are critical for achieving sustainable energy use across the country.

Energy Savings and Emission Reduction Achievements
The Bureau of Energy Efficiency (BEE) has achieved remarkable success in reducing energy consumption and carbon emissions across various sectors. Through initiatives like the Standards and Labelling Program and the Perform Achieve and Trade (PAT) Scheme, BEE has facilitated significant energy savings. For instance, the PAT Scheme alone has resulted in the reduction of over 26 million tonnes of oil equivalent and 70 million tonnes of CO2 emissions. These achievements demonstrate the effectiveness of BEE’s policies and programs in promoting energy efficiency and sustainability. The impact is further evident in the adoption of energy-efficient technologies and practices across industries, buildings, and transport sectors. BEE’s efforts have not only contributed to environmental protection but also supported India’s commitment to global climate goals. Regular progress reports and success stories highlight the transformative impact of these initiatives.
